What skills and experience we're looking for

We are looking to appoint an ambitious and creative First Aider who is enthusiastic about helping students learn in a strong supportive environment.

As the principal First Aider, you will play a crucial role in ensuring the health and safety of our students, staff and visitors. You will be responsible for overseeing and coordinating all aspects of first aid, promoting a culture of safety and responding promptly to medical incidents. You will also ensure pupils with ongoing medical needs are supported in school in line with their Individual Health Care Plans, administer approved medication to students and maintain accurate records, including those for statutory requirements.

The successful candidate should demonstrate a proactive approach with excellent communication skills to work effectively with students and be the first point of contact for all First Aid.
